Correspondence, minutes of meetings, reports of committees, notices and orders, camp publications, rules and regulations, financial reports, medical records, studies of food and nutrition, organization charts, and other records relating chiefly to the administration of the Santo Tomas Internment Camp, a Japanese World War II prisoner of war camp in Manila, Philippines, where Cecil served as secretary of the executive committee and director of the department of sanitation and health during his internment. Also includes liberation reports and other records pertaining to the Los Baños Internment Camp in Los Baños, Philippines, where Cecil was later interned.
Insurance company executive.
